Truth

6 1 1
                                    


If truth be told secrets dance between us
The way you spun me at a party,
In your arms, twirling across the floor
Landing with my back to your chest.
My head is on your shoulders.

If truth be told our soft kisses speak
A thousand words before dinner
On a lazy Sunday afternoon.
In January's grey light
We hold each other's hands and smile

If truth be told I like the secrets we have
Waiting to be unwrapped by the other.
Dancing around our facts or fictions
With soft kisses in the silence
Wondering, is there a truth to tell.
